44 High Street, Heanor, DE75 7EX is a freehold terraced property built before 1900. The property offers approximately 538 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have one bedroom.

The estimated current market value of the property is £103,422 , which equates to approximately £192 per square foot. It was last sold on 15 Sep 2020 for £79,000. Since then, the value has increased by £24,422, representing a 30.9% increase, or approximately 5.4% per year.

The current estimated value of £103,422 is:

  • 54.3% lower than the average property price on High Street
  • 12.5% lower than the average in the DE75 7EX postcode area
  • and 52.9% lower than the average price for Heanor as a whole

This property has had 2 EPC inspections with recorded tenure information. It was recorded as owner-occupied both times. This suggests the property has typically been lived in by its owners, which often reflects longer-term residency and more consistent maintenance.

At the most recent EPC inspection on 25 February 2020, the property was recorded as owner-occupied.

44 High Street, Heanor, Amber Valley, Derbyshire, DE75 7EX has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of E, based on the latest assessment carried out on 25 Feb 2020.

This property uses electric storage heaters as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from off-peak electric immersion heater.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 2 Jun 2009. The rating of E remains the same, but the energy efficiency score improved by 6.3%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The main heating energy efficiency improving from poor to average, while the heating system type remained the same (electric storage heaters).
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in all f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 50% of fixed outlets, with efficiency changing from very good to good.
